Not being obtuse but we are both missing it a bit, you are comparing a car with much more horsepower and more doors etc to the TT instead of comparing the TT to a ToyBaru or some other coupe. that the S3 or the Golf R are faster does not matter. Different body style and engine size. Compare the R to the TTS and you…